AI Technical Summary

Technical Problem

Existing lens manufacturing processes face challenges in producing complex corrective lenses for myopia and hyperopia due to high complexity and the need to comply with surfacing, coating, and edging processes, while conventional lenses often fail to correct near vision inaccuracies.

Method used

A manufacturing method involving additive manufacturing to create a functional diffusive structure with securing elements, which is embedded in the lens element, allowing it to withstand subsequent surfacing, coating, and edging processes, and includes features like color filters and light diffusion patterns.

Benefits of technology

The method enables the production of versatile lenses with complex diffusive structures that can correct myopia and hyperopia, reduce progression, and enhance near vision accuracy, while maintaining compatibility with standard manufacturing processes.

Abstract

The disclosure relates to a manufacturing method of a lens element (1) comprising the steps of a - producing a functional diffusive structure (5) configured to attenuate at least one eye discomfort; b - forming at least three securing elements (7) to fit the functional diffusive structure (5) to a mould; c - mounting the functional diffusive structure (5) in the mould via the securing elements (7); and d - moulding the lens 5element (1) by filling the mould to embed the functional diffusive structure (5) in the lens element (1).
